SIR – It is the 100th anniversary of the RAF. Given the change in mission profile and the use of airborne equipment by all the military, alongside the need to reduce costs, I wonder if we should now disband the Royal Air Force and reabsorb its function into the Army and Navy.
This would enable greater investment in front-line forces. The RAF did a tremendous job for us, but we shouldn’t continue with it just because we love it. David Goodwin
